// Broker upgrade notes for plugin authors:
// Quillbus 4.x replaces the legacy 3.x wire protocol. Plugins must
// construct the client with explicit protocol negotiation enabled,
// or connections to the Larkfield cluster will be silently downgraded
// and dropped after 30s. Topic names are unchanged. For local testing
// against the sandbox broker, authenticate with the key below.

API key for bafof-bagaf: qvz2-qi

Handover for the Pictogrid release: the thumbnail generation queue backed up Tuesday after the resize workers hit a memory ceiling. I bumped worker count to six and added a dead-letter drain; backlog cleared overnight. No code changes needed for the cut, but watch queue depth during the rollout. Runbook and dashboards are linked on this page.

runbook for badug-kadup: https://confluence.zemvarlabs.internal/projects/browse/display/projects/bd1b

The contrast-audit stage on the Brightlane pipeline started failing after we bumped the Pallino theme tokens. The failures are legitimate: three button states in the Quarrel dashboard dropped below 4.5:1. No security impact, but the gate blocks merges until the palette fix lands. Sanne has the remediation branch up for review. The failing run's token is recorded below for traceability.

build token for kagaf-hahof: htk14_9d3d4d26d7d8de

## Releases — Duskwell Backfill Scheduler

Each release of the nightly backfill scheduler must be tagged, built from a clean tree, and verified before promotion to the production ring. Pause all pending backfill windows first; an in-flight window surviving a deploy can double-process partitions. Signed release artifacts are required by the deploy gate, which validates against the key recorded below.

rollout seal: bky19_M1Zvn1YQwEBTy4XxP3H

Changed defaults in Splitfork, our assignment service. Bucketing now uses sticky hashing per account instead of per session, and the holdout slice grew from 2% to 5%. Callers relying on session-level reassignment must opt in explicitly. Review the diff against the new baseline; the updated default configuration is listed below.

config for tagep-kajof:
[casir]
port = 6379
region = south-1
host = casir.paliqdyn.example
team = tamax
timeout_ms = 250
retries = 2